Overall song meaning
Nenjodu Nee is a soulful romantic track sung by Saindhavi from the movie DeAr, composed by G. V. Prakash Kumar with lyrics by Gkb. The song portrays a quiet, deep emotional awakening and tender longing within a relationship. The protagonist reflects on unspoken emotions and silent love that surrounds her heart despite emotional barriers. Using evocative imagery like a flower blooming through a solid rock, the song conveys resilience in love and the hopeful anticipation of emotional reunion and tenderness.
Writing craft
Poetic devices
Metaphor
“Perumpaarai keeri oru poo pookuthae”
Compares love emerging through tough emotional barriers to a delicate flower blooming through a solid rock.
Paradox / Oxymoron
“Naan pesidum mounangal nee”
Combines contradictory ideas of speaking and silence to express deep, unuttered understanding.
Simile
“Thodu vaanamaai mazhai meghamaai”
Compares their bond and timing to the natural meeting of the horizon and rain clouds.
Refrain / Anaphora
“Ennanadho yedhaanadho”
Repetition of questioning phrases to emphasize emotional bewilderment and wonder.

Trivia
DeAr (2024) stars G. V. Prakash Kumar alongside Aishwarya Rajesh. G. V. Prakash Kumar composed the soundtrack, and the track is sung by his former spouse Saindhavi, making it one of their memorable collaborations.
